The Haldi ceremony is a cherished pre-wedding ritual in many South Asian cultures, filled with vibrant colors, fun music, dancing, and playful traditions. During the ceremony, a paste made of turmeric (haldi), sandalwood, and rose water is applied to the bride’s skin. This ritual is believed to purify the body, ward off negativity, and bring a radiant glow before the big day.
